The public discussion took place for the master’s student (Ali Hussein Ali Hadi) Department of Physics- College of Science - University of Anbar on Monday, September 1, 2025, in Ibn Sina Hall. for his tagged thesis

" Synthesis and Evaluation Effect of Metal Oxide Nanoparticles for Enhancing Vitamin D Levels in Mushrooms "

This study successfully synthesized ZnO and TiO? nanoparticles using Pulsed Laser Ablation in Liquid (PLAL). UV-Vis and zeta potential analyses showed that higher laser energies (700 mJ for ZnO, 500 mJ for TiO?) produced smaller, more stable nanoparticles. XRD confirmed crystalline structures: ZnO in the hexagonal wurtzite phase with traces of Zn and ZnO?, and TiO? mainly tetragonal with some metallic Ti. EDX verified the expected elemental compositions, while TEM images revealed nearly spherical nanoparticles with average sizes of ~12 nm (ZnO) and ~9 nm (TiO?). When applied to oyster mushrooms (Pleurotus ostreatus), nanoparticles significantly enhanced growth, yield, and nutritional value: biological efficiency increased up to 78.4%, fresh weight by ~83%, and vitamin D, C, protein, and mineral contents were notably enriched. Importantly, toxicity assessments confirmed the treatments were safe, with no harmful residues or biochemical alterations detected.
